In regards to the CDL or trucking violation that you have received in Plano, Texas, you must respond to your charges by the date that they are due. If you fail to respond to your citation, neither challenging it nor pleading guilty to it in due time, it may eventually fall into warrant status. When a traffic ticket or city ordinance violation falls into warrant, it means that a traffic warrant has been issued by the court for the motorist at question. If a traffic warrant has been issued for you by the Plano Municipal Court, you may be taken into custody by police because of it at potentially any time of the day or night.
